#be9418 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#be9418 is composed of 74.5% red, 58%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 22.1% magenta, 87.4%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 44.8 degrees, a saturation of 77.6% and a lightness of 42%. #be9418 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ff30 with #7d2900. Closest websafe color is: #cc9900.

Shades and Tints of #be9418

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100c02 is the darkest color, while #fffef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#be9418

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c6b6a is the less saturated color, while #ce9c08 is the most saturated one.
